Anda di halaman 1dari 10

DISTRIBUTED SYSTEM

Joox,PNJ.ac.id, idn.times, Gojek, McDonalds

Jahuda Dolf Bacas 4817050163

Suci Rahmadhani 4817050415

Wahyu Aji Pamungkas 4817040448

CCIT 6 SEC

TEKNIK INFORMATIKA DAN KOMPUTER

POLITEKNIK NEGERI JAKARTA

2019-2020
Joox

A. Client - Server System Model


Pada client a menggunakan web service yang memiliki antarmuka yang
dijelaskan dalam format mesin-processable (khusus WDSL). System ini berinteraksi
dengan menggunakna pesan SOAP, biasanya dsampingkan menggunakan HTTP
dengan serialisasi XML dalam hubungannya dengan web lainnya yang terkait standar.
Webs service yang memungkinkan untuk dipanggil dengan menggunaknan
protocol lain seperti SMTP (Simple Mail Protocol).

B. Jaringan yang digunakan

Pada aplikasi website joox menggunakkkan jaringan WAN (Wide Area


Network). Wide Area Network (WAN) adalah jaringan yang jangkauannya
mencakup daerah geografis yang luas, seringkali mencakup sebuah negara bahkan
benua. WAN memungkinkan terjadinya komunikasi diantara dua perangkat yang
terpisah jarak yang sangat jauh. Biasanya, fungsi ini akan sangat berguna bagi sebuah
perusahaan yang memiliki banyak kantor cabang, di luar negeri dan juga diluar kota.

Jangkauan yang digunakan menggunakan wan,yang mana jaringan tersebut


pada pengimpementasiannya dapat diakses memnggunakan berbasis internet
-

C. Transport Layer JOOX


JOOX menggunakan transport layer berupa XML. XML (eXtensible Markup
Language) adalah sebuah bahasa markup seperti HTML yang didesain untuk
menyimpan dan mengantarkan data. XML itu sendiri memiliki keunggulan
diantaranya:
1. XML tidak tergantung pada platform atau system operasi yang digunakan.
2. Hasil pencarian data lebih akurat.
3. Dokumen XML dapat diterjemahkan ke dalam beberapa format yang berbeda
karena dalam XML data dan instruksi dipisahkan.
Pnj.ac.id

A. Client - Server System Model


Pada website ini menggunakan TCP/IP yang digunakan untuk koneksi dan
menerima HTML yang dikirim oleh browser. Yamg terprogram dalam system dan
digunakan untuk komunikasi data dalam internet ataupun Local Area network
(LAN) yang terhubung.
Dijalankan secara virtual melalui media transmisi data,saluran dial up
atuapun ethernet

B. Jaringan
Pada website ini menggunakan LAN (Local Area Network) kelebiha pada jaringan
LAN yang digunakan pada website ini adalah :
• Memeiliki berbagai sumber daya resource degan LAN maka pengguna dapaat
saling berbagi sumber daya yang adadisetiap computer
• Dat terpusat data yang ada pada setiap computer didlam suatu jaringan LAN
dpaat disimpan disuatu tempat yaitu server. Dengan adanya server maka setiap
pengguna dapat mengakses file yang ada dimasing-masing computer.

C. Transport Layer PNJ.ac.id


Pnj menggunakan protocol transport layer berupa TCP untuk memudahkan
client dalam mengakses website. TCP/IP adalah standar komunikasi data yang
digunakan oleh komunitas internet untuk proses tukar-menukar data dari satu komputer
ke komputer lain dalam jaringan internet.
Idn.times

A. Client - Server System Model


Pada website idn times berbasis website TLS yang digunaknan dalam web
beowsing dalam pengiriman email,penerimaan email dengan juga VoIP (voice-over-
ip). Dalam web browser dengan HTTp dalam pengiriman dan penerimaan email,ada
port yang digunakan untuk melakukan koneksi TLS/SSL.

B. Transport Layer IDN Times


IDN Times menerapkan Network News Transfer Protocol (NNTP) pada
transport layernya. Protocol ini digunakan untuk mengangkut artikel berita antara
server berita dan untuk membaca dan memposting artikel oleh aplikasi klien pengguna
akhir. Port TCP 119 yang terkenal dicadangkan untuk NNTP. Port TCP 433 (NNSP)
yang terkenal dapat digunakan saat melakukan transfer besar-besaran dari satu server
ke yang lain. Ketika klien terhubung ke server berita dengan
Transport Layer Security (TLS), TCP port 563 sering digunakan. Ini kadang-
kadang disebut sebagai NNTPS. Atau, koneksi teks biasa melalui port 119 dapat diubah
untuk menggunakan TLS melalui perintah STARTTLS.

C. Arsitektur Jaringan
IDN Times menggunakan Arsitektur jaringan seperti gambar dibawah. Gambar
dibawah menjelaskan bahwa ketika web browser yang digunakan user akan mengirim
permintaan yang diinginkan user dan jika suda hditerima akan muncul apa yang
diinginkan user.
Gojek

A. Client - Server System Model


System ini berinteraksi dengan menggunakna pesan SOAP, biasanya
dsampingkan menggunakan HTTP dengan serialisasi XML dalam hubungannya
dengan web lainnya yang terkait standar.

Pada server yang digunakan berbasis pengguna dengan sistem informasi mereka yang
berbasis cloud.

B. API (Application Programming interfce)


Pada aplikasi gojek menggunakan API yang berkesinambungan dengan aplikasi
gojek . aplikasi yang digunakan berupa :
• Google Maps
• Google place
• Transjakarta API
• Apotikantar API
C. Arsitektur Jaringan
Dalam ekosistem big pada Gojek, mereka menggunakan infrastruktur yang beragam.
Yang terbaru, Gojek telah mengimplementasikan Google BigQuery dan Google Cloud
Storage untuk proses warehousing mereka. Hal ini dianggap pas karena mereka
hanya perlu membayar biaya bulanan saja dengan menyewa Virtual Private Server
tanpa harus membangun infrastruktur sendiri.
D. Transport Layer Gojek
Website gojek menggunakan protocol TCP (Transfer Control Protocol) dalam transport
layer mereka, TCP berfungsi untuk memberikan layanan transport bagi setiap data dan
paket data yang ditransmisikan di dalam sebuah jaringan, terutama yang sedang
diproses di dalam lapisan transport layer.

Mcdonalds

A. Client - Server System Model

Pada aplikasi ini menggunakan SSL (Secure socket Layer )yang tersmabung dengan
browser pada web pengguna . client berupa web browser atau antara mail server dan
mail client. Dan berjalan saangat aman dari pihak lain yang tidak berkepentingan .
Proses encripsi penggunaan SSL :
• Cient/browse meminta koneksi SSL
• Kektika server membalas permintaan dengan mengirimkan SSL certificate yang
berisi Public key
• Client menerima dan memfalidasi keabsahan certificate tersebut (mengecek
pihak CA yang mendatangi ,masa berlaku,owner dll)
• Client membuat Symmetric Encription key(Session key) dan mengenkripsi
dengan public key yang ada didalam certificate lalu mengirimnya keserver.
• Server mendeskripsikan dengan private key data daric lien yang berisi
symmetric private key data daric lien yang berisi symmentric session key dan
menggunakan key tersebut untuk mengirim data dari server ke client

B. Arsitektur Jaringan
MCD bergerak untuk memberi konsumen lebih banyak informasi tentang produk
makanannya menggunakan sistem blockchain yang akan melacak makanan dari
pabrik ke restoran

Untuk upaya ini, foodchain bekerja dengan Microsoft untuk memanfaatkan Layanan
Azure Blockchain dalam melacak pengiriman makanan dari seluruh dunia, membawa
"digital, real-time traceability" ke rantai pasokannya, menurut pengumuman dari
Microsoft.
Dengan kemitraan ini, layanan blockchain Microsoft akan mencatat semua
perubahan di sepanjang perjalanan makanan pada buku besar bersama, memberi
peserta "pandangan yang lebih lengkap" dari rantai pasokan.

C. Transport Layer
Pada website McD menerapkan Hypertext Transfer Protocol Secure (HTTPS).
Selain itu website ini juga menggunakan Secure Socket Layer (SSL) atau Transport
Layer Security(TLS) sebagai sublayernya. Kedua protokol tersebut memberikan
perlindungan yang memadai dari serangan eavesdroppers, dan man in the middle
attacks

Anda mungkin juga menyukai